The first time I went to cash a paycheck at a new bank and asked for a roll of halves. Pulled 2 shiny new 1968's.
I was immediately hooked and ordered a box.
5-40%'s and a 1987p.

The following week got one more box from a different bank. Got exactly the same as before.
5-40% and a 1987p.
it's been an addiction ever since.
8-12 boxes a week for 6 months now.
